Transaction 570868a429788b7a69e8414751c4d14d3fca835b73ea160d0285a2f75864357b
1 Input
2 Outputs
- 570868a429788b7a69e8414751c4d14d3fca835b73ea160d0285a2f75864357b:0
- 570868a429788b7a69e8414751c4d14d3fca835b73ea160d0285a2f75864357b:1
value 5025179
address 1FJJ4paNng8dUszjSNifskLpoHqCZ4xQ6P
value 2997768
address 1N6LjUoTAHRWhMDtMTapPafjThvpbYp37a